目录系统架构设计数据采集模块实现数据处理与分析算法存储与优化策略可视化与预警功能测试与部署方案项目技术支持可定制开发之功能创新亮点源码获取详细视频演示 文章底部获取博主联系方式同行可合作系统架构设计采用分布式架构分为数据采集层、数据处理层、数据存储层和应用层。数据采集层通过物联网设备如传感器实时收集PM2.5、SO₂、CO₂等环境数据。数据处理层使用Apache Kafka或Flink进行实时流处理清洗和标准化数据。数据存储层结合时序数据库如InfluxDB和分布式存储如HDFS实现高效存取。应用层通过可视化工具如Grafana和API接口提供数据展示与分析功能。数据采集模块实现部署高精度传感器网络覆盖目标监测区域如工业区、城市中心。传感器需支持无线传输协议如LoRaWAN或NB-IoT确保低功耗与广域覆盖。数据采集频率根据污染物特性设定PM2.5建议每分钟一次SO₂和CO₂可每5分钟一次。边缘计算节点初步过滤异常值减少传输负载。数据处理与分析算法实时流处理采用窗口函数如滑动窗口计算污染物浓度均值、峰值和趋势。异常检测使用机器学习模型如Isolation Forest或LSTM时序预测标记突增或持续超标数据。长期分析通过Spark MLlib实现污染物扩散模型结合气象数据风速、湿度评估污染源影响范围。公式示例污染物扩散简化模型C ( x , y ) Q 2 π u σ y σ z exp ( − y 2 2 σ y 2 ) [ exp ( − ( z − H ) 2 2 σ z 2 ) exp ( − ( z H ) 2 2 σ z 2 ) ] C(x,y) \frac{Q}{2\pi u \sigma_y \sigma_z} \exp\left(-\frac{y^2}{2\sigma_y^2}\right) \left[\exp\left(-\frac{(z-H)^2}{2\sigma_z^2}\right) \exp\left(-\frac{(zH)^2}{2\sigma_z^2}\right)\right]C(x,y)2πuσyσzQexp(−2σy2y2)[exp(−2σz2(z−H)2)exp(−2σz2(zH)2)]其中Q QQ为污染源强度u uu为风速σ y \sigma_yσy、σ z \sigma_zσz为横向与垂直扩散参数。存储与优化策略时序数据存储采用InfluxDB的分片和压缩策略降低存储空间占用。热数据保留30天冷数据归档至HDFS并压缩为Parquet格式。建立复合索引时间戳区域ID加速查询。定期使用Apache Beam进行数据批处理生成日/月聚合报表。可视化与预警功能前端使用ECharts或D3.js实现动态地图热力图分色显示污染物浓度等级。预警模块设置阈值触发规则如CO₂1000ppm持续1小时通过短信或邮件通知管理人员。开放RESTful API支持第三方系统集成响应格式为JSON包含字段示例{timestamp:2023-09-20T14:30:00Z,location:{lat:34.0522,lng:-118.2437},metrics:{PM2.5:45.2,SO2:0.12,CO2:420}}测试与部署方案分阶段实施先在实验环境模拟10万传感器节点的压力测试JMeter工具验证系统吞吐量目标≥5000条/秒。部署时采用Kubernetes容器化方案按区域划分微服务实例。运维阶段通过Prometheus监控系统健康度设置自动扩缩容策略应对数据高峰。项目技术支持前端开发框架:vue.js数据库 mysql 版本不限数据库工具Navicat/SQLyog/ MySQL Workbench等都可以后端语言框架支持1 java(SSM/springboot/Springcloud)-idea/eclipse2.Nodejs(Express/koa)Vue.js -vscode3.python(django/flask)–pycharm/vscode4.php(Thinkphp-Laravel)-hbuilderx可定制开发之功能创新亮点多种统计效果:可以多种统计图效果展示1、合并效果 2、单独展示3、随模块一起。可以多种元素展示出不同的统计图效果3、智能预警功能:项目可设置数值、日期到达临界值会触发弹框提醒 亮点描述1、达到触发点的信息增加颜色标识 2、同时增加文字触发提醒设置提醒语有相同字段的数据会触发弹框提醒例如设置状态提醒特急/加急/一般 增加自定义提醒语如库存不足请补货视频弹幕功能:视频支持弹幕功能 亮点描述可对相关视频进行评论评论后会自动对评论信息上传至相关视频形成弹幕设计二维码三端:可以生成一个二维码的图片用手机扫一扫可以查看二维码里面的信息。此信息只能使用查看可以登录进去操作就是类似于真机调试神经网络协同过滤NCF 随机森林推荐算法:两个算法叠加进行推荐使推荐算法更有个性需要推荐的都可以使用此功能作为最新的亮点源码获取详细视频演示 文章底部获取博主联系方式同行可合作查看详细的视频演示或者了解其他版本的信息。所有项目都经过了严格的测试和完善。对于本系统我们提供全方位的支持包括修改时间和标题以及完整的安装、部署、运行和调试服务确保系统能在你的电脑上顺利运行需要成品或者定制如果本展示有不满意之处。点击文章最下方名片联系我即可~,总会有一款让你满意
基于大数据的环境检测系统pm so2 co2的设计与实现
目录系统架构设计数据采集模块实现数据处理与分析算法存储与优化策略可视化与预警功能测试与部署方案项目技术支持可定制开发之功能创新亮点源码获取详细视频演示 文章底部获取博主联系方式同行可合作系统架构设计采用分布式架构分为数据采集层、数据处理层、数据存储层和应用层。数据采集层通过物联网设备如传感器实时收集PM2.5、SO₂、CO₂等环境数据。数据处理层使用Apache Kafka或Flink进行实时流处理清洗和标准化数据。数据存储层结合时序数据库如InfluxDB和分布式存储如HDFS实现高效存取。应用层通过可视化工具如Grafana和API接口提供数据展示与分析功能。数据采集模块实现部署高精度传感器网络覆盖目标监测区域如工业区、城市中心。传感器需支持无线传输协议如LoRaWAN或NB-IoT确保低功耗与广域覆盖。数据采集频率根据污染物特性设定PM2.5建议每分钟一次SO₂和CO₂可每5分钟一次。边缘计算节点初步过滤异常值减少传输负载。数据处理与分析算法实时流处理采用窗口函数如滑动窗口计算污染物浓度均值、峰值和趋势。异常检测使用机器学习模型如Isolation Forest或LSTM时序预测标记突增或持续超标数据。长期分析通过Spark MLlib实现污染物扩散模型结合气象数据风速、湿度评估污染源影响范围。公式示例污染物扩散简化模型C ( x , y ) Q 2 π u σ y σ z exp ( − y 2 2 σ y 2 ) [ exp ( − ( z − H ) 2 2 σ z 2 ) exp ( − ( z H ) 2 2 σ z 2 ) ] C(x,y) \frac{Q}{2\pi u \sigma_y \sigma_z} \exp\left(-\frac{y^2}{2\sigma_y^2}\right) \left[\exp\left(-\frac{(z-H)^2}{2\sigma_z^2}\right) \exp\left(-\frac{(zH)^2}{2\sigma_z^2}\right)\right]C(x,y)2πuσyσzQexp(−2σy2y2)[exp(−2σz2(z−H)2)exp(−2σz2(zH)2)]其中Q QQ为污染源强度u uu为风速σ y \sigma_yσy、σ z \sigma_zσz为横向与垂直扩散参数。存储与优化策略时序数据存储采用InfluxDB的分片和压缩策略降低存储空间占用。热数据保留30天冷数据归档至HDFS并压缩为Parquet格式。建立复合索引时间戳区域ID加速查询。定期使用Apache Beam进行数据批处理生成日/月聚合报表。可视化与预警功能前端使用ECharts或D3.js实现动态地图热力图分色显示污染物浓度等级。预警模块设置阈值触发规则如CO₂1000ppm持续1小时通过短信或邮件通知管理人员。开放RESTful API支持第三方系统集成响应格式为JSON包含字段示例{timestamp:2023-09-20T14:30:00Z,location:{lat:34.0522,lng:-118.2437},metrics:{PM2.5:45.2,SO2:0.12,CO2:420}}测试与部署方案分阶段实施先在实验环境模拟10万传感器节点的压力测试JMeter工具验证系统吞吐量目标≥5000条/秒。部署时采用Kubernetes容器化方案按区域划分微服务实例。运维阶段通过Prometheus监控系统健康度设置自动扩缩容策略应对数据高峰。项目技术支持前端开发框架:vue.js数据库 mysql 版本不限数据库工具Navicat/SQLyog/ MySQL Workbench等都可以后端语言框架支持1 java(SSM/springboot/Springcloud)-idea/eclipse2.Nodejs(Express/koa)Vue.js -vscode3.python(django/flask)–pycharm/vscode4.php(Thinkphp-Laravel)-hbuilderx可定制开发之功能创新亮点多种统计效果:可以多种统计图效果展示1、合并效果 2、单独展示3、随模块一起。可以多种元素展示出不同的统计图效果3、智能预警功能:项目可设置数值、日期到达临界值会触发弹框提醒 亮点描述1、达到触发点的信息增加颜色标识 2、同时增加文字触发提醒设置提醒语有相同字段的数据会触发弹框提醒例如设置状态提醒特急/加急/一般 增加自定义提醒语如库存不足请补货视频弹幕功能:视频支持弹幕功能 亮点描述可对相关视频进行评论评论后会自动对评论信息上传至相关视频形成弹幕设计二维码三端:可以生成一个二维码的图片用手机扫一扫可以查看二维码里面的信息。此信息只能使用查看可以登录进去操作就是类似于真机调试神经网络协同过滤NCF 随机森林推荐算法:两个算法叠加进行推荐使推荐算法更有个性需要推荐的都可以使用此功能作为最新的亮点源码获取详细视频演示 文章底部获取博主联系方式同行可合作查看详细的视频演示或者了解其他版本的信息。所有项目都经过了严格的测试和完善。对于本系统我们提供全方位的支持包括修改时间和标题以及完整的安装、部署、运行和调试服务确保系统能在你的电脑上顺利运行需要成品或者定制如果本展示有不满意之处。点击文章最下方名片联系我即可~,总会有一款让你满意